Which method is better: credit cards or e-wallets?
Choosing between credit cards and e-wallets depends on your personal preferences. Here’s a comparison:
| Feature | Credit Cards | E-Wallets |
|---|---|---|
| Processing Time | Instant | Instant |
| Fees | Usually none | May vary |
| Security | Secure, but details shared | Highly secure, less detail shared |
| Withdrawal Speed | 3-5 days | 1-2 days |
As you can see, e-wallets often have the edge in security and withdrawal speed, while credit cards are more familiar to many players.
